PTFE Insulated Hook-up/Equipment Wires as per US Navy's MIL-W-16878 or British BS-2G-210 or Indian JSS 51034 are suitable for harsh environment applications. The very thin and robust insulation makes ideal for use in the high-temperature environment or for applications with reduced weight or size requirements.

Characterstics:

Excellent thermal stability (suitable for use from -200°C to +260°C).

They propagate neither flame nor fire.

Resistance to solder iron damage.

Insulation is inert to virtually all known Acids, chemicals and solids.

Excellent mechanical and electrical properties with a Small size & weight.

Insulation has low dielectric constant (2.1) and dissipation factor (below 0.0003), it's high dielectric strength and insulation resistance shows minimum changes over wide temperature, frequency and voltage fluctuations.

Quality Assurance

100% Physical and Electrical testing.

A minimum of 3 layers of PTFE tape, wrapped and sintered, provides balanced bi-axially oriented, concentrically placed insulation.

Minimum shrinkage/deformation and no 'run-away' problem at soldering-iron temperatures.

Surface as good as extruded wire without the disadvantages of extruded PTFE insulation in fine-gauge thin-wall types.

Certified minimum BREAK DOWN VOLTAGE (on samples) to ensure higher, uniform and predictable performance.

Controlled tigher tolerance on weight, PTFE density and conductor resistance.
